private assertStrictTimeBounds(transaction: Transaction): void {
const timeBounds = (transaction as any).timeBounds;
const maxTime = Number(timeBounds?.maxTime);
const nowSeconds = Math.floor(Date.now() / 1000);

if (
!Number.isFinite(maxTime) ||
maxTime <= nowSeconds ||
maxTime - nowSeconds > this.TRANSACTION_TIME_BOUND_SECONDS
) {
throw new Error(
`Transaction envelope must include strict time_bounds of ${this.TRANSACTION_TIME_BOUND_SECONDS}s or less`,
);
}
}

private async submitWithTimeoutListener(
transaction: Transaction,
publicKey: string,
): Promise<any> {
const pending = this.registerPendingTimeBoundTransaction(
transaction,
publicKey,
);

try {
return await Promise.race([
this.server.submitTransaction(transaction),
new Promise<never>((_, reject) => {
pending.timer = setTimeout(() => {
const activePending = this.pendingTimeBoundTransactions.get(
pending.hash,
);

if (!activePending) {
return;
}

activePending.timedOut = true;
this.pendingTimeBoundTransactions.delete(pending.hash);
console.warn(
`[StellarService] Transaction ${pending.hash} exceeded ${this.TRANSACTION_TIME_BOUND_SECONDS}s time-bound. Recycling local assignment.`,
);
reject(
new LocalTransactionTimeoutError(pending.hash, pending.publicKey),
);
}, Math.max(pending.expiresAtMs - Date.now(), 0));
}),
]);
} finally {
this.clearPendingTimeBoundTransaction(pending.hash);
}
}

private registerPendingTimeBoundTransaction(
transaction: Transaction,
publicKey: string,
): PendingTimeBoundTransaction {
const createdAtMs = Date.now();
const hash = transaction.hash().toString("hex");
const pending: PendingTimeBoundTransaction = {
hash,
publicKey,
createdAtMs,
expiresAtMs:
createdAtMs + this.TRANSACTION_TIME_BOUND_SECONDS * 1000,
timedOut: false,
};

this.pendingTimeBoundTransactions.set(hash, pending);
return pending;
}

private clearPendingTimeBoundTransaction(hash: string): void {
const pending = this.pendingTimeBoundTransactions.get(hash);

if (!pending) {
return;
}

if (pending.timer) {
clearTimeout(pending.timer);
}
this.pendingTimeBoundTransactions.delete(hash);
}
